Sales Engineer / Area Sales Manager / CNC Sales Engineer required for a global leading engineering manufacturer.

 

The successful Sales Engineer / Area Sales Manager / CNC Sales Engineer will work remotely and be responsible for new business development and key account management across Scotland selling CNC products and equipment used for CNC machining including cutting tools, shrink-fit machines, balancing machines, tool pre-setters, tool holders, work holding solutions, and end mills.

 

The Sales Engineer / Area Sales Manager / CNC Sales Engineer must have a technical background in CNC, CNC machining, cutting tools or machine tools and have good access to locations in the Central Belt such as Glasgow, Edinburgh, Falkirk, Livingston, Stirling, Dunfermline.

Sales Engineer / Area Sales Manager / Key Account Manager Role

  • Business development and key account management across Scotland, selling precision equipment and accessories used in CNC machining including cutting tools, shrink-fit machines, balancing machines, tool pre-setters, tool holders, work holding solutions, and end mills.
  • Assist with the installation of CNC products and precision equipment at customer sites.
  • Manage and grow existing client relationships to drive CNC tooling sales.
  • Liaise with various engineering departments.
  • Fully remote position covering Scotland.

 

Sales Engineer / Area Sales Manager / Key Account Manager Requirements

  • Experience as a Sales Engineer, Key Account Manager, Account Manager, Area Sales Manager, Technical Sales Engineer, Sales Representative, or similar within Precision engineering and CNC.
  • CNC machinists, setters, or operators seeking to move into a sales role will also be considered.
  • Must have a technical background in CNC, CNC machining, cutting tools or machine tools.
  • A technical mechanical engineering or manufacturing qualification, apprenticeship, HNC, HND, or degree would be advantageous.
  • Full clean driving licence and willingness to meet clients across Scotland, focusing on the Central Belt such as Glasgow, Edinburgh, Falkirk, Livingston, Stirling, Dunfermline.
